Dishes
Large Plate Green BeansA home-style dish made with long green beans stir-fried with garlic and chili, served in a large bowl for family meals.
Spicy Pot-Braised ChickenDry Pot Chicken is a dish featuring free-range chicken as the main ingredient, paired with potatoes, green peppers, and onions, stir-fried quickly at high heat. The chicken, first blanched, is then stir-fried with seasonings and vegetables, finished with a special dry pot sauce for rich, layered flavor.
Spicy Pork Intestines Stir-fryDry Pot Pig Intestines is a dish primarily made with pig intestines, stir-fried with various spices and vegetables. First, the intestines are thoroughly cleaned and cut into segments, then stir-fried together with seasonings until golden and crispy. Finally, seasoning ingredients are added and stirred evenly to create a dish that is fragrant and rich in texture.
Fried Pork and Edamame RiceA hearty dish made with stir-fried pork mince and edamame mixed into steamed rice, offering a savory and satisfying meal.
Braised Wuchang FishA Chinese dish featuring Wuchang fish braised in a savory sauce of soy sauce, sugar, and wine, resulting in tender, flavorful meat.
Sizzling IntestinesSizzling pork intestines dish made with cleaned and blanched large intestine, stir-fried on a hot plate with onions and green peppers. Seasoned with soy sauce, cooking wine, garlic, and ginger for rich flavor and tender texture.
Cucumber Stir-Fried with PorkA classic Chinese home-style dish featuring cucumbers and pork stir-fried together for a fresh, savory taste.
